Summary :
The trial of the January 2015 attacks came halfway through.
Since it opened under high tension on September 2, the Palais de Justice in Paris has plunged into the horror of these three days of murderous madness.
Among the 200 civil parties, survivors and relatives of the victims follow one another before the special assize court to tell the story of January 7, 8 and 9, 2015, which brought mourning to France.
After the overwhelming testimonies of the killing at Charlie Hebdo, our three reporters from the Parisian Police Justice service heard the survivors of the Montrouge and Hyper Cacher attacks in particular.
Continuation of the story by Louise Colcombet, Zoé Lauwereys and Timothée Boutry for Code Source.
